CVE-2005-3952 is an old SQL injection issue in PHP Labs Top Auction. A remote attacker could manipulate category, type, or search inputs to make the application run unintended database queries. The main business risk is exposure or alteration of auction and customer data if this legacy software remains reachable. Likely exposure is limited to organizations still running PHP Labs Top Auction, especially version 1.0, on public or internal web servers. The provided CPE and vendor fields are incomplete, so inventory validation is necessary. Prioritize as a legacy exposure cleanup item. It is not KEV-listed in the bundle, but public exploit information and potential database impact justify prompt inventory and removal or isolation of any live instance. Mitigation focus: Identify and remove any exposed PHP Labs Top Auction deployments.; Check vendor or maintainer guidance for fixed versions or official workarounds.; If still required, restrict access to trusted users and networks..
